MATH 170 · Distance is a choice · Norms

Three rulers on one grid L1 · L2 · L∞

Distance is not one thing. Walk the streets and you count blocks; fly and you cut the corner; ask "what was the biggest single step?" and you get a third answer. Move the two points and watch three rulers disagree — then switch modes and see what a circle looks like to each of them.
